Quant aux territoires, ce sont des subdivisions administratives d'un espace géographique appartenant au gouvernement fédéral et dont l'administration est attribuée au Parlement canadien, qui, par une loi, peut y décentraliser des pouvoirs législatifs en les accordant à des organes politiques chargés d'administrer la partie de territoire qui leur est assignée. This was in response to the violent rebellions of 1837–38.The Durham Report (1839) recommended the guidelines to create the new colony with the Act of Union.The Province of Canada was made up of Canada West (formerly Upper Canada) and Canada East (formerly Lower Canada).
